H. pylori infection tends to harm the lining of the stomach causing inflammation, and diseases such as ulcers, and gastritis. The most acute and harmful form of an H. pylori infection is stomach cancer. Hence, the timely treatment is necessary to stop the H. pylori infection from worsening into ulcers and stomach cancer. The reason for this infection is either contaminated foods and water containing the H. pylori bacteria, or from unclean utensils having it. The increase in use of clean water has reduced the cases of H. pylori infection.
H. pylori infection is very common and a large number of people suffer from it every year. This disease also occurs to children so the test for this infection is also done very frequently. Moreover, the results from this test are helpful in monitoring the effectiveness of the treatment.
This infection damages the protective layer over the lining of the stomach due to which acids present in the digestive system may come in direct contact with the stomach’s lining and damage it. Many tests are used to diagnose the H. pylori infection such as the stool test, endoscopy, and the breath test. However, the most common test for diagnosing an H. pylori infection is the breath test.
The H. pylori test is different from most other diagnostic tests in that it makes the diagnosis by measuring the amount of carbon dioxide contained in the breath of the person who exhales the air after drinking a citric juice containing an unharmful form of urea. Generally, most diagnostic tests use a blood, urine, DNA, saliva, or nasal secretions sample.
